Key job responsibilities
Category Strategy & Positioning: Define go-to-market strategies for GenAI, ML, and Data & Analytics categories

Integrated Campaign Development: Design and orchestrate execution for omni-channel campaigns targeting technical and business decision makers, from data scientists to CxO executives evaluating AI transformation initiatives

Partner Collaboration: Work with leading AI/ML partners to develop co-marketing programs, joint value propositions, and scale-focused partner marketing initiatives

Technical Content & Thought Leadership: Work with solution architects, partners, and technical specialists to create content that demonstrates real-world AI/ML use cases, ROI models, and implementation guidance

Event Strategy & Field Marketing integration: Lead category presence at key industry events (such as re:Invent, partner events)

Performance Analytics & Optimization: Establish sophisticated measurement frameworks tracking everything from category awareness to solution adoption and customer lifetime value

Cross-functional Collaboration: Partner closely with Marketing, Sales, Technology, Operations, and Partner teams to ensure force multiplication and an exception experience for our customers and partners

BASIC QUALIFICATIONS
9+ years of professional non-internship marketing experience
Experience using data and metrics to drive improvements
Experience with Excel or Tableau (data manipulation, macros, charts and pivot tables)
Experience building, executing and scaling cross-functional marketing programs
Experience driving direction and alignment with cross-functional teams
5+ years of developing and managing acquisition marketing or channel programs experience
P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S
Experience driving direction and alignment with large cross-functional teams and agency partners
- Cloud marketplace experience - familiarity with software procurement, ISV/channel ecosystems, and multi-dimensional business models
Deep understanding of AI/ML buyer personas, use cases, and technical evaluation criteria
Experience with Account-Based Marketing from strategy through execution
Mix of global and regional marketing experience and proven delivery of mass scale marketing programming
